Application –> Count – Auto sampling & Auto clear APW
Activate/deactivate auto sampling.
After activation, the
➜ Load samples on the scale.
The number of samples must be equal to the reference number. Once the sample is
steady, the terminal performs auto sampling.
The information on the display changes from sample weight to the number of samples
piece.
Activate/deactivate auto clear APW (average piece weight).
After activation, the
➜ When unloading the scale, the APW is cleared.
Once the sample is steady, the terminal performs auto clear APW, exits counting mode
and returns to weighing mode.
Application –> Log files – Set log files
If activated, all weighing information will be saved in log files on the SD card (secure
digital memory card).
The SD card slot is found on the front of the scale. You can insert the card if you need
to use the log files function.
In addition to the 6 fixed items, further information can be saved.
1. Select the item number.
2. Assign contents to this item.
